Position Overview: This position is for a Senior Research Assistant to work on Wireless Sensor Networks (WSNs). The successful candidate will be responsible for working on modelling and simulation of energy savings in WSNs using the concept of measurement prediction, as well as physically building WSNs to confirm the new methodology being developed.

If you are passionate about WSNs and want to work in an area in which hardware meets software, please apply by submitting your resume and cover letter. Duties:
  • Develop and implement models and simulations for investigating the effect of new measurement prediction methods on the energy budget of sensor nodes.
  • Design and build a small-scale WSN to test the new methodology being developed.
  • Conduct experiments to validate the mathematical models and identify areas for improvement.
  • Analyze data and write a report detailing the findings of the research with the goal of publishing at a conference or journal.
